Moscow insists on involvement in Nord Stream investigation

MOSCOW, Oct 5 (PRIME) -- Moscow insists on its and Germany’s participation an international investigation of the Nord Steam pipeline sabotage, Deputy Foreign Minister Sergei Vershinin said in a news conference on Wednesday.

“It is understandable that no decisions were made (at a September 30 meeting of the U.N. Security Council), but a joint opinion was voiced that it was a sabotage and that an investigation is necessary,” he said.

“We support that because real investigation should be done with Russia’s participation, obviously. It is important to involve Germany in the investigation.”
